How they compare
New Zealand currently reports 2,291 kilowatt-hours per person against 2,236 kilowatt-hours per person in Chile, a difference of 55 kilowatt-hours per person.
The two have swapped places 4 times across 61 shared years of data; in 1965 it was New Zealand ahead.
Chile ranks 45th and New Zealand ranks 43rd of 215 countries.
Across the 7 decades both report, Chile averaged higher in 2 and New Zealand in 5.
Head to head by decade
| Decade | Chile | New Zealand | Difference | Ahead |
|---|---|---|---|---|
| 1960s | 1,485 kilowatt-hours per person | 6,425 kilowatt-hours per person | 4,940 kilowatt-hours per person | New Zealand |
| 1970s | 1,128 kilowatt-hours per person | 5,225 kilowatt-hours per person | 4,097 kilowatt-hours per person | New Zealand |
| 1980s | 1,136 kilowatt-hours per person | 4,187 kilowatt-hours per person | 3,051 kilowatt-hours per person | New Zealand |
| 1990s | 2,304 kilowatt-hours per person | 3,803 kilowatt-hours per person | 1,499 kilowatt-hours per person | New Zealand |
| 2000s | 2,291 kilowatt-hours per person | 5,038 kilowatt-hours per person | 2,746 kilowatt-hours per person | New Zealand |
| 2010s | 4,466 kilowatt-hours per person | 3,576 kilowatt-hours per person | 890.15 kilowatt-hours per person | Chile |
| 2020s | 2,917 kilowatt-hours per person | 2,752 kilowatt-hours per person | 164.83 kilowatt-hours per person | Chile |
Averages of every year both report within each decade.
